Goldman plans five-year leveraged trigger notes tied to S&P, Russell

By Susanna Moon

Chicago, June 20 – GS Finance Corp. plans to price 0% index-linked notes due June 30, 2022 linked to the lesser performing of the S&P 500 index and the Russell 2000 index, according to a 424B2 fil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ission.

If each index finishes at or above its initial level, the payout at maturity will be par plus 1.6 to 1.7 times the gain of the worse performing index.

If either index falls by up to the 50% threshold the payout will be par.

Otherwise, investors will receive par plus the return of the worse performing index with full exposure to any losses.

The notes are guaranteed by Goldman Sachs Group, Inc.

Goldman Sachs & Co. LLC is the agent.

The notes will price on June 27.

The Cusip number is 40054LFE9.
